Chinese culture is shaped by ancient philosophy, dynastic history, festivals, family traditions, and language.
This category explores customs like Lunar New Year, Confucian values, calligraphy, traditional music, regional cuisines, and folk beliefs. Daily life reflects deep respect for ancestors, harmony, and community.
From art and clothing to food and education, Chinese identity is closely tied to both heritage and modern adaptation.
